The South Dakota state senate has voted 30 to 4 to pass legislation to ban genital mutilation of children or use of powerful drugs for sex changes.  Some of the drugs used as "puberty blockers" for children are the same ones usesd for chemcial castration of rapists and have lots of nasty side effects.  The bill has already overwhelmingly passed the state house, and Governor Kristi Noem has announced she will sign it.  SD is the latest state to ban these barbaric practices on children.
